Ingredients

1 lb grated mozzarella cheese
3 cups flour , divided
1/2 cup dried parsley flakes
1/3 cup grated parmesan cheese
1 package dried Italian salad dressing mix
1 cup milk
2 extra large eggs
8 boneless skinless chicken breast halves
vegetable oil ( for frying )
grated parmesan cheese
chopped parsley ( to garnish )
Luby's Cafeteria Italian Chicken Breast is a classic recipe that has been served in Luby's Cafeteria for many years. The dish is made with boneless skinless chicken breasts that are coated in a mixture of flour, cheese, and Italian seasoning before being fried and baked to perfection. Once cooked, the chicken breasts are topped with additional parmesan cheese and served hot, making them a popular main dish for any occasion.

Instructions

1.Preheat oven to 375°F.
2.In a shallow bowl, combine mozzarella cheese, 1 cup of flour, parsley flakes, parmesan cheese, and Italian salad dressing mix.
3.In another shallow bowl, whisk together milk and eggs.
4.Pound chicken breasts to 1/4 inch thickness.
5.Dip each chicken breast first in the egg mixture, then in the cheese mixture, coating well.
6.Heat 1/8 inch of o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Fry each chicken breast for 2-3 minutes on each side, or until golden brown.
7.Transfer chicken breasts to a baking sheet and sprinkle with additional parmesan cheese.
8.Bake for 15-20 minutes or until chicken is cooked through.
9.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ot.
